B & A Limited (BOM:508136)
India flag India · Delayed Price · Currency is INR
385.00
0.00 (0.00%)
At close: Feb 13, 2026

B & A Ratios and Metrics

Millions INR. Fiscal year is Apr - Mar.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 2021
Period Ending
Feb '26 Mar '25 Mar '24 Mar '23 Mar '22 Mar '21
1,1941,4621,378756784459
Market Cap Growth
-33.41%6.08%82.19%-3.54%70.68%56.00%
Enterprise Value
1,9342,0201,7041,3121,275931
Last Close Price
385.00471.60444.55243.59250.84146.27
PE Ratio
12.7317.7512.856.633.263.22
PS Ratio
0.430.550.480.260.270.19
PB Ratio
0.630.890.900.540.600.44
P/TBV Ratio
0.731.051.050.630.690.51
P/FCF Ratio
---28.623.234.63
P/OCF Ratio
--4.357.062.572.87
EV/Sales Ratio
0.700.760.590.450.440.38
EV/EBITDA Ratio
17.6721.589.725.722.962.95
EV/EBIT Ratio
35.0158.6113.757.333.303.43
EV/FCF Ratio
-17.23--49.645.259.37
Debt / Equity Ratio
0.460.410.320.220.190.39
Debt / EBITDA Ratio
7.937.202.801.320.571.29
Debt / FCF Ratio
---11.441.014.10
Net Debt / Equity Ratio
0.260.210.120.110.110.28
Net Debt / EBITDA Ratio
4.513.601.010.660.340.92
Net Debt / FCF Ratio
-4.40-2.40-2.755.710.602.93
Asset Turnover
0.871.001.241.411.511.41
Inventory Turnover
1.602.643.113.133.643.56
Quick Ratio
0.700.680.880.660.700.54
Current Ratio
1.531.531.811.971.961.34
Return on Equity (ROE)
6.43%6.93%9.51%10.22%22.77%18.10%
Return on Assets (ROA)
1.09%0.82%3.30%5.38%12.57%9.68%
Return on Invested Capital (ROIC)
1.97%1.53%6.18%8.03%20.60%15.08%
Return on Capital Employed (ROCE)
2.50%1.80%6.60%11.30%25.60%21.90%
Earnings Yield
7.86%5.64%7.78%15.10%30.73%31.11%
FCF Yield
-9.40%-9.59%-4.69%3.50%30.98%21.62%
Dividend Yield
---0.21%0.80%0.68%
Payout Ratio
1.50%3.41%3.41%5.43%1.29%-
Total Shareholder Return
-0.02%--0.21%0.80%0.68%
Source: S&P Global Market Intelligence. Standard template. Financial Sources.